Best High Schools in Medical District, Memphis, TN

Medical District, Memphis, TN has 2 high schools with 1,411 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Medical District score 27%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 37%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Medical District underperform exp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Medical District, Memphis, TN

Neighborhood-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Medical District, Memphis, TN has a total population of 3,809 with 20%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 79%, and 20%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
